Section 7-205 - Power of Attorney General

Ask AI about this
On request of the Commissioner, the Attorney General may proceed in a court or before a federal unit to enforce: (1) a decision of the Commissioner made under this title; (2) a subpoena issued under this title; (3) an order of the Commissioner passed under this title; or (4) the collection of a civil penalty assessed under this title.
